3.2

Menu Structures and Parameter Descriptions

The following sections provide graphic representations of the

320IS Plus

menu structures. In the actual menu

structure, the settings you choose under each parameter are arranged horizontally. To save page space, menu

choices are shown in vertical columns. The factory default setting appears at the top of each column.
Most menu diagrams are accompanied by a table that describes all parameters and parameter values associated

with that menu. Default parameter values are shown in bold type.
To exit configuration mode, with the display showing

CONFIG

., press the ZERO key to scroll up.

Menu

Menu Function

CONFIG

Configuration

Configure grads, zero tracking, zero range, motion band, overload, tare function, push button
enable, and digital filtering parameters.

FORMAT

Format

Set format of primary and secondary units, display rate.

CALIBR

Calibration

Calibrate indicator. See Section 4.0 on page 41 for calibration procedures.

SERIAL

Serial

Configure EDP and printer serial ports.

PROGRM

Program

Set regulatory mode, unit ID, auto zero, consecutive number values, and battery standby.

PFORMT

Print Format

Set print format used for gross and net tickets. See Section 6.0 on page 53 for more
information.

SETPNT

Setpoints

Configure setpoints. See Section 7.0 on page 56 for setpoint configuration.

DIGIN

Digital Input

Assign digital input functions. See Section Figure 3-12. on page 38 for more information.

ALGOUT

Analog Output

Configure analog output. See Section 3.2.8 on page 38 for analog output configuration.

VERS

Version

Display installed software version number.

Table 3-1. 320IS Plus Menu Summary
